($member[mb_point] > 0) ? $member[mb_point] : 0; 가 어떤 의미인가요? 정보
($member[mb_point] > 0) ? $member[mb_point] : 0; 가 어떤 의미인가요?- gnooonlylove 자기소개 아이디로 검색 회원게시물
- 1,597
본문
아래 ($member[mb_point] > 0) ? $member[mb_point] : 0; 가 어떤 의미인가요?
$member[mb_point] > 0
0보다크면? 잘이해가 안가서요...
음수이면 0으로 잡아주는건가요?
// 코멘트쓰기 포인트설정시 회원의 포인트가 음수인 경우 코멘트를 쓰지 못하던 버그를 수정 (곱슬최씨님)
$tmp_point = ($member[mb_point] > 0) ? $member[mb_point] : 0;
if ($tmp_point + $board[bo_comment_point] < 0 && !$is_admin)
alert("보유하신 포인트(".number_format($member[mb_point]).")가 없거나 모자라서 코멘트쓰기(".number_format($board[bo_comment_point]).")가 불가합니다.\\n\\n포인트를 적립하신 후 다시 코멘트를 써 주십시오.");
$member[mb_point] > 0
0보다크면? 잘이해가 안가서요...
음수이면 0으로 잡아주는건가요?
// 코멘트쓰기 포인트설정시 회원의 포인트가 음수인 경우 코멘트를 쓰지 못하던 버그를 수정 (곱슬최씨님)
$tmp_point = ($member[mb_point] > 0) ? $member[mb_point] : 0;
if ($tmp_point + $board[bo_comment_point] < 0 && !$is_admin)
alert("보유하신 포인트(".number_format($member[mb_point]).")가 없거나 모자라서 코멘트쓰기(".number_format($board[bo_comment_point]).")가 불가합니다.\\n\\n포인트를 적립하신 후 다시 코멘트를 써 주십시오.");
댓글 전체
$tmp_point = ($member[mb_point] > 0) ? $member[mb_point] : 0;
(조건) ? 조건 만족시 값 : 조건 만족 하지 않을시 값
↓
if($member[mb_point] > 0)
$tmp_point = $member[mb_point];
else
$tmp_point = 0;
↓
$tmp_point = 0;
if($member[mb_point] > 0) $tmp_point = $member[mb_point];
(조건) ? 조건 만족시 값 : 조건 만족 하지 않을시 값
↓
if($member[mb_point] > 0)
$tmp_point = $member[mb_point];
else
$tmp_point = 0;
↓
$tmp_point = 0;
if($member[mb_point] > 0) $tmp_point = $member[mb_point];
완전 이해되네요 ㅋ
친절한 답변 감사합니다. ^^;
친절한 답변 감사합니다. ^^;
if문을 간략히 적은겁니다.^^
간략하게 하는게 있었군요. 감사합니다. ㅎ